How to spot a bad SNHOND3

As some of you have read, I got what seemed to be a defective unit from Logjam. However, here's what I found when I got a replacement unit. The harnesses were different! If you get one of these, make sure the harness looks like the good one:

See the red and white wires on the left? There was apparently nothing wrong with the unit itself, just the harness.
